Featuring Paul J. Kim
Paul performs regularly at colleges, churches, and events throughout the country and has been involved with Kollaboration LA for the past several years. What sets his music and live performances apart are his vocal abilities: beatboxing, harmonies, and lyrics. He gives new meaning to the term: “one-man-band”. Using a loop pedal machine on stage that allows him to produce live multi-track vocal instrumentals, he performs original songs and covers; effortlessly moving from one genre to another (acoustic, hip-hop, spoken word). Having always been the class clown growing up, Paul also has the gift of connecting with any audience through his sense of humor, wit, and charm. Check out his site at pjkmusic.com
